Small Open Economy (HOS)

John Gilbert and Edward Tower

GAMS Models for Trade Theory from Utah State University, Department of Economics and Finance

Abstract: This file contains a simple GAMS program to simulate a small, open economy of the HOS type, as described in Chapter 10 of Gilbert and Tower (2009) "An Introduction to GAMS Modeling for International Trade Theory and Policy" Jon M. Huntsman School of Business, Department of Economics and Finance Working Paper Number 2009-04.
